What is a Shipping Container?
Shipping containers are standardized, resilient, and stackable boxes created for the storage and transport of items. They are usually made from steel and come in several sizes, including the basic 20-foot and 40-foot containers. These containers are important for the intermodal transport system that integrates several modes of transport, consisting of ships, trucks, and trains.

Shipping container providers play a vital function in the general logistics supply chain. They are associated with different functions, consisting of the production, sourcing, and circulation of shipping containers. Here are a few of the crucial functions they perform:

Manufacturing and Sourcing: Suppliers make containers in various specs or source them from manufacturers. They make sure quality control to adhere to worldwide Shipping Container Homes standards.

Sales and Leasing: Many providers use both sales and leasing choices, allowing services to select the best suitable for their operational requirements. This flexibility is particularly crucial for companies with fluctuating storage and transport requirements.

Custom Modifications: Some suppliers offer custom modifications, such as adding insulation, windows, or custom shelving, to satisfy specific requirements. This is particularly useful in sectors like construction and retail.

Repurposing and Resale: Used shipping containers are frequently offered for resale. Providers refurbish and repurpose these containers for different applications, reducing costs and environmental waste.

Delivery and Logistics: Shipping container providers frequently deal with the logistics of providing containers to customers, which can consist of collaborating with freight providers and handling transport schedules.

Choosing the Right Shipping Container Supplier
Picking the best shipping container supplier is vital for taking full advantage of operational efficiency. Here are some aspects to consider:

Reputation and Experience: Assess the supplier's track record in the industry. Reviews and testimonials can provide insight into their reliability and service quality.

Variety of Products: Ensure the supplier uses a diverse series of containers to fulfill different needs, from basic to customized types.

Customization Capabilities: If custom modifications are a concern, confirm that the supplier has the tools and competence to accommodate your particular demands.

Rates Structure: Compare pricing among numerous providers to ensure you're getting a fair offer, but consider quality over amount, as the least expensive alternative might not be the best.

Service and Support: Evaluate the level of client service. Suppliers who provide support throughout the getting process and beyond can include significant value.
